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Seagoville, TX
The cost of tile floor water damage restoration in Seagoville, TX can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on the specific needs of your property and may include: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water involved.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the level of moisture involved. |
| Repair and Rest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air. |
| Assessment and Planning | $200 – $1,000 | The complexity of the job and the number of technicians involved. |
| Equipment Rental | $500 – $2,000 | The type and quantity of equipment needed. |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The level of contamination and the type of disinfectant used. |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a discussion with one of our technicians. We offer free estimates and can help you focus on repairs to ensure you get the most value for your money.
